feat: extract cluster schema to lib global state
Change algorithm for working with cluster schema (#18). Before change schema was parsed from string on every query.Now schema store in global state and update at first query after new cartridge schema applying. Also rust-fmt was applied.
Showing
- src/bucket.rs 28 additions, 10 deletionssrc/bucket.rs
- src/cluster_lua.rs 23 additions, 24 deletionssrc/cluster_lua.rs
- src/errors.rs 2 additions, 2 deletionssrc/errors.rs
- src/lib.rs 5 additions, 5 deletionssrc/lib.rs
- src/parser.rs 50 additions, 21 deletionssrc/parser.rs
- src/query.rs 220 additions, 76 deletionssrc/query.rs
- src/schema.rs 26 additions, 12 deletionssrc/schema.rs
- src/simple_query.rs 13 additions, 14 deletionssrc/simple_query.rs
- src/union_simple_query.rs 31 additions, 17 deletionssrc/union_simple_query.rs
Loading
Please register or sign in to comment